Man it was so nice when cell phones would look like mass storage to
computers. Just copy your data to and from no problem. Apple never was
down for this since they were in the music sales business but Android
did. Can't remember if my Nokia N900 used to work like that or not.
There is also a specific camera protocol called PTP that was around, but
not sure if Windows Mobile phones used it.
Might have to spin up a VirtualBox as someone else said and run Windows +
the original connectivity software for the phone. But then it becomes a
question if the virtualbox host shim for USB will allow the app in
virtualbox to really talk to the phone. Been hit or miss in my experience.
